man nap sleep outdoor bench downtown Vancouver
Robson Square is a landmark civic centre and public plaza, located in Downtown Vancouver, British Columbia. It is the site of the Provincial Law Courts, UBC Robson Square, government office buildings, and public space connecting the newer development to the Vancouver Art Gallery.
Size: 5472px × 3648px
Location: Vancouver, British Columbia, Canada
Photo credit: © picturelibrary /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: bench, downtown, man, nap, outdoor, sleep, vancouver